A Benue State Magistrate Court sitting in Makurdi on Tuesday remanded one Dr Kadev Kenneth Kelvin at the federal correctional facility in Makurdi over alleged cyberstalking.

Dr. Kadev, in a Facebook post on March 12, 2023, stated that he stitched the lacerated anus of the Benue State Publicity Secretary of the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P), Bemgba Iortyom, after he was sodomized in Abuja prison in 2017, as disclosed by David Mzer.

The first information report from the police reads: "On the 13/03/2023, a criminal petition was received by the Commissioner of Police written by D.K. Iorhemba and Co. as Barrister and Solicitors on behalf of Bemgba Iortyom, the PDP Publicity Secretary, Benue State, stating that one Kadev Kenneth Kelvin, a medical doctor who works at Kadev Health Systems Services of No.9 opposite Holy Covent, Otukpo Road, Makurdi, made damaging comments on him on the 12/03/2023 at about 1300hrs, on Facebook stating that, when Kadev Kenneth Kelvin was chatting with one Gabriel Terungwa Shange, he chatted that, my brother, if Bemgba Iortyom wants to go dirty, just inform me, the day he found out that, I was the medical doctor that stitched his lacerated anus when he was sodomized in Abuja prison in 2017, he blocked me.”

 

During the police investigation, Kelvin was arrested and the statement made on Facebook was screenshot for evidence. He reportedly confessed to committing the said offence.

 

According to the police, the offence contravenes Section 24(1)(a)(b)(i) of the Cybercrimes Prohibition and Prevention Act, 2015.

 

No plea was taken for want of jurisdiction.

 

The police prosecutor, Inspector S. O. Itodo informed the court that an investigation into the matter was still ongoing.

 

He asked the court for another date to enable the prosecution to prove its case.

 

After listening to Greg Mbasuen, who is the counsel for the complainant in the matter, Bemgba Iortyom and G. I. Tseen Esq, who held the brief of P. T. Anderson Esq, for Dr. Kadev, the Chief Magistrate, N.E. Kakaan remanded the accused person at the federal correctional facility in Makurdi.

He, thereafter, adjourned the matter to May 24, 2023 for further mention.
